Watch Your Stern (1960)
Director: Gerald Thomas
Movie review
From Time Out Film Guide
The 'Carry On' crew edge out of port under a flag of convenience as able seaman Connor dons a variety of disguises to stop the Admiralty top brass discovering he's accidentally destroyed a set of hush-hush torpedo plans. Milligan and Sykes steal the picture as a couple of chatty electricians, otherwise the awful puns and dodgy double entendres are all shipshape and Bristol-fashion.Author: TJ
